The Two-Ocean War

"The Two Ocean War" by U.S. naval historian Samuel Eliot Morison, is a short version of his multi-volume "History of United States Naval Operations in World War II". This one-volume book is quite similar to the longer version.

Published 1963 by Little, Brown and Company, Library of Congress Catalog 63-8307 (first ed.).
